3-23-10: Ribes uva crispa

Ribes uva crispa Janhs Prairie gooseberry is a lush ornamental shrub with delicious and high quality reddish-pink fruit ready to eat late June through August.

This gooseberry species was selected from the wild native gooseberries in Alberta Canada by Dr. Otto L. Jahn whom it was named after. Jahns Prairie gooseberry grows to about 4'-5', is very disease- resistant and produces large yields of fruit whose quality is equivalent to European gooseberries. Plant in full sun or part-shade and start enjoying this beautiful and tasty plant in your garden.
